Former PTV Newscaster and Social Figure Jahan Ara Moeen Passes Away in Islamabad

Jahan Ara Moeen, a former newscaster of Pakistan Television (PTV) and a respected social personality, has passed away in Islamabad.
According to family sources, she died after a period of illness. Details of the exact cause of death were not immediately shared.
Moeen began her career with Pakistan Television News in 1973. She initially worked on background commentary for English news bulletins. Her skills and dedication soon earned her a place as a regular newscaster on PTV. She remained associated with PTV News until 1999 and was widely recognised for her accurate delivery, precise pronunciation, and professional on-screen presence. Colleagues remembered her for her commitment to staying well-informed about current affairs and the thorough preparation she put into every bulletin.
In addition to her media career, Moeen contributed to the field of education. She served as a visiting faculty member at several universities. She also worked as a consultant with major international organisations, including the United Nations, the World Bank, UNESCO, and the United Nations Development Programme (UNDP).
News of her death has been met with sorrow among former colleagues in the media, academic circles, and those who worked with her on social and developmental projects. Family members and friends have begun receiving messages of condolence.
Funeral arrangements are expected to be announced by the family in due course. She is survived by her immediate family.
